The vector of malaria parasites is
Options
- AMale Anopheles mosquito
- BMale Culex mosquito
- CFemale Anopheles mosquito
- DFemale Culex mosquito
Correct answer
C. Female Anopheles mosquito
Step-by-step solution
Malaria is caused by the Plasmodium parasite. The vector responsible for transmitting the malaria parasite to humans is the female Anopheles mosquito. Female mosquitoes require a blood meal for the development of their eggs, whereas male mosquitoes feed on plant nectar and do not bite humans. Answer: Female Anopheles mosquito
